Om Prakash Narwal assumed charge as Faridabad’s Commissioner of Police (CP) on Saturday. He took charge from the outgoing CP Rakesh Kumar Arya, who will join as the IGP of Administration and, Law and Order.

Narwal was accorded a guard of honour by the district police at the CP office this morning. Abhishek Jorwal, DCP (Headquarters), along with DCP (Crime) Hemendra Kumar Meena, DCP Jasleen Kaur, DCP (NIT) Kuldeep Singh, Ballabgarh DCP Anil Kumar and DCP (Traffic) Usha, welcomed the new Commissioner of Police.

Narwal said his priority as the CP was to maintain a law and order, besides ensuring resolution of issues faced by the people.
